Tom Cruise lands like a force

Ryan Gosling spilled the beans on his Happy Sad Confused podcast with Josh Horowitz on March 19 while promoting his sci-fi thriller ‘Project Hail Mary’. “I wasn’t there, it’s a day I’m not,” he said, lamenting cosmic time.The crew was in the middle of firing when chaos erupted. “They were shooting and they heard a helicopter, and they had to cut it. It’s Tom Cruise. He lands in the middle of the set,” Gosling said. “He grabs a camera and starts filming the action scene.”Director Shawn Levy captured the moment in photos sent directly to Gosling. “Shawn sends a picture [of] him and Cruise and Flynn in the mud,” Gosling said, highlighting Cruise’s knee-deep scene with newcomer Gray. “It’s like a shot with Flynn in the mud, Flynn filming, and it’s his first, it’s not his first movie, but it’s one of his first movies and it was an incredible moment,” he added.Levy previously teased Cruise’s involvement in a New York Times profile from January. Cruise didn’t go alone; he grabbed a camera to film a lightsaber duel, and some of the footage made the final cut.
